In a landscape saturated with police procedurals and crime thrillers, SonyLIV’s Gyaarah Gyaarah (Eleven Eleven) emerges not just as another whodunit, but as a structural marvel. Adapted from the Korean classic Signal, the Indian iteration—starring Raghav Juywal, Kritika Kamra, and Dhairya Karwa—carves its own identity through gritty realism and a high-concept premise: a walkie-talkie that connects two police officers from different timelines—1990 and 2016.
